    Overview of Louisville, KY

    Louisville, KY, is known for its rich history and vibrant culture. Nestled along the Ohio River, this city showcases an exciting mix of attractions that appeal to various visitors.

    Key Attractions

    • Louisville Slugger Museum: Home to the iconic baseball bats, this museum offers a deep dive into baseball history. You can participate in a bat-making demonstration and even take home a mini bat.
    • Kentucky Derby: The most famous horse race in the United States draws crowds every May. Attending this event offers a glimpse into local traditions, fashion, and of course, horse racing.
    • Muhammad Ali Center: Dedicated to the life and legacy of the boxing champion, this center showcases his achievements and contributions to humanity. It provides educational programming and inspiring exhibits.

    Culinary Scene

    Louisville boasts a diverse culinary landscape.

    • Hot Brown: This open-faced sandwich is a local favorite, typically featuring turkey, bacon, and Mornay sauce. Try it at the Brown Hotel, where it originated.
    • Bourbon Trail: The city is at the heart of Kentucky’s bourbon industry. Several distilleries offer tours and tastings, allowing you to experience the state’s rich distilling heritage firsthand.

    Neighborhoods

    • Cherokee Park: This park, designed by Frederick Law Olmsted, offers scenic walking trails, picnic spots, and a relaxing atmosphere. It’s a great place to unwind and enjoy nature.
    • NuLu: The East Market District, known as NuLu, is famous for its trendy eateries, art galleries, and boutiques. Explore local shops and enjoy unique dining experiences.

    Safety Statistics in Louisville

    Understanding safety statistics can help you make informed decisions while traveling to Louisville, KY. The city’s crime rates and trends provide insight into what you can expect during your visit.

    Crime Rates and Trends

    Louisville experiences various crime rates, with property crimes being the most reported incidents. In 2022, the overall crime rate was approximately 5,217 cases per 100,000 residents. Violent crime accounts for about 1,200 cases per 100,000 residents. Most reported violent crimes include assault, robbery, and homicide.

    Comparison with Other Cities

    When comparing Louisville to similar cities, the crime rate falls slightly above the national average. For instance, in 2022, Louisville’s violent crime rate was higher than cities like Nashville (974 cases per 100,000 residents) but lower than cities like Baltimore (2,247 cases per 100,000 residents).

    City Violent Crime Rate (per 100,000 residents)
    Louisville 1,200
    Nashville 974
    Baltimore 2,247

    These statistics indicate varying safety levels across cities. While Louisville faces challenges, it remains a city where many visitors enjoy their time. Staying aware of your surroundings and following local advice can enhance your safety during your visit.

    Travel Tips for Staying Safe

    When visiting Louisville, being proactive about your safety enhances your experience. Below are essential tips to keep in mind.

    Transportation Safety

    • Use Reputable Services: Rely on well-known taxi companies or rideshare apps like Uber or Lyft for transportation. They provide safety features, such as GPS tracking.
    • Stay Alert: Always pay attention to your surroundings when using public transport or walking in unfamiliar areas. Avoid distractions like your phone.
    • Travel in Groups: Whenever possible, travel with friends or companions, especially at night. Groups tend to deter unwanted attention.
    • Plan Your Route: Familiarize yourself with the area before you go. Use maps or navigation apps to avoid getting lost.
    • Choose wisely: Select accommodations in safe neighborhoods. Areas like Downtown and NuLu have excellent options and well-lit streets.
    • Read Reviews: Check online reviews from travelers. Look for mentions of safety and neighborhood experiences in recent reviews.
    • Lock Up: Always secure your hotel room when you leave. Use all locks on doors and consider additional security measures like portable door locks.
    • Keep Valuables Hidden: Store valuable items, like passports and electronics, in the hotel safe. Avoid drawing attention to belongings in public places.
